Why

gpg --list-keys, abbreviated -k, prints the public keyring: for each key a pub line with the algorithm, key ID and creation date, and one or more uid lines with the associated names and addresses. The counterpart --list-secret-keys, or -K, shows the private keys you hold, which is how you confirm you can actually decrypt or sign. Both read from the GnuPG home directory, ~/.gnupg by default or whatever --homedir names.
